Metalliboridit
Metalliboridit is a collective term for inorganic compounds that contain metal and boron atoms. These materials exhibit a wide range of properties due to the diverse combinations of metals and the unique characteristics of boron. Boron, with its electron-deficient nature, readily forms strong covalent bonds with other boron atoms, leading to intricate cage-like structures. When combined with metals, these structures are stabilized, creating compounds with high melting points, exceptional hardness, and good chemical stability.
